Output 6366305b9ac8b49e91cbbe123c285ae2a40d66b4ced6871197872caf756511d8:10

value
1611800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c58b4a14b1009139774a6f511479b44148e19f OP_EQUAL
address
3NBVw7pZEfYayDHF9EPCKwPo7vGtXaBy5b
transaction
6366305b9ac8b49e91cbbe123c285ae2a40d66b4ced6871197872caf756511d8
spent
true